Overview
Marketing embraces a range of compulsory skills, competences and knowledge that makes our students competitive in today’s digital era. Our BSc Marketing course allows you to build your knowledge and skills by combining academic rigour with real-world application, leading you into a structured career in marketing.
The course has been developed with input from marketing practitioners and world-leading researchers to synthesise the most relevant advancements in marketing discipline with industry demand. Our broad range of topics includes everything from fundamental marketing theories to digital marketing, consumer behaviour and brand management.
You will also study the key aspects of management theory alongside students from other management disciplines, developing an understanding of how marketing fits into larger organisational workplace structure.
This degree is the same as the three-year course until you get to year three, which you will spend studying (in English) at a partner institution overseas.

There are various options through which a student can get a post study work visa in the UK.
Tier 1 Graduate Entrepreneur Visa for the graduates with a genuine and credible business idea.
Tier 2 (General) is the leading immigration visa to work in the UK.
Tier 4 Doctorate Extension Scheme is for students who have completed their Ph.D. and is valid for 12 months for them to work, look for work or set up a business.
Tier 5 Youth Mobility is for individuals of certain countries like Australia, Canada, Japan, Monaco, Hong Kong, South Korea, Taiwan, and New Zealand aged between 18 -30 who wish to move to the UK.
Tier 5 GAE is for individuals who want to come to the UK for work experience, training, research or a fellowship.
UK Ancestry is for individuals who are a citizen of a commonwealth and plan to work in the UK and have a grandparent who was born in the UK.

Master of Engineering in Civil Engineering with Study Abroad
This degree will equip you to find solutions to environmental problems and to design large and unique structures, such as buildings, bridges, dams and coastal defences. If you are creative, enjoy design and aspire to improve the built environment we live in then civil engineering is for you.
At Bristol you will have access to our world-class laboratory facilities, including the most advanced earthquake shaking table in Europe.
The Study Abroad degree is a great opportunity to broaden your view of the world and experience a different culture. You will study at one of our partner universities in Australia, Canada, the US, Hong Kong or Singapore in your third year. There is no direct entry onto the course but you can transfer from the other courses if you reach a high academic standard in your first two years.
The first two years provide a strong foundation in engineering, including mathematics, structures, soil and fluid mechanics, computing and surveying, as well as optional units. More optional units are introduced in subsequent years, allowing you to pursue your interests while developing key professional skills.
Your third year overseas will mirror the third-year curriculum at Bristol. To find out more about where you can study overseas visit Global Opportunities. You will return to Bristol for your fourth and final year.
Design is central to the course and this is reflected in the projects you will undertake. In the first year you will develop a solution to an open-ended problem, such as designing and making a model bridge. Later projects include steel work, reinforced concrete, geotechnical design and water supply systems.
You will take part in an exciting group design project in the fourth year, combining all your learning as you tackle realistic design challenges identified through our industry links. Design projects range from transportation to smart cities and from skyscrapers to sustainable housing.
Our graduates are highly sought after by top employers, including civil engineering consultancies, utility companies, the army, public transport, power generation and supply companies.

Master of Science in Chemistry with Industrial Experience
MSci Chemistry with Industrial Experience will deepen your understanding of the subject and prepare you for a variety of career options, especially in the chemical industry. It is also a good pathway into postgraduate study.
The first two years are common to all of our degree courses. You will study fundamental concepts in inorganic, organic and physical chemistry and applications in areas such as analytical, environmental, materials and theoretical chemistry.
You will develop your ability to design experiments and interpret results and learn key skills through our chemistry-specific communications and mathematics units.
In your third year you will gain invaluable experience in industry working in a paid position for a major chemical company. Our students have worked for AstraZeneca, Bayer Crop Science, Croda, GlaxoSmithKline and Johnson Matthey in recent years.
Working in industry will allow you to develop real-world expertise and specialise in an area of science that you find interesting. The transferable skills that you gain will prove invaluable in helping to shape your future career.
Your final year includes a 20-week research project in which you will work with an academic member of staff and their research team on a current challenge in chemistry.

Bachelor of Arts in Music and Spanish
This joint honours degree combines a full course in music with the study of Spanish language, literature and culture, providing you with a valuable skill set that is ideally tailored to the increasingly globalised workplace.
Music offers a broad range of units in musicology, composition and performance, across diverse styles and genres. These are complemented by weekly concerts, regular masterclasses and performances in the department, and opportunities to get involved in the dynamic music scene in Bristol.
Spanish is the second most widely spoken European language in the world and is the second language of the US. Studying a modern language in the context of its speakers' history, literature, experience and outlook can broaden horizons and challenge preconceptions, including those about one's own language and country.
You will spend your third year abroad in a Spanish-speaking environment, which will enable you to refine your language skills and cultural knowledge.

Bachelor of Arts in Theatre and German
This degree combines theatre with the study of German. The course offers an enriching experience with exciting intellectual challenges and a wide range of options that will allow you to pursue your own interests.
Both departments encourage strong synergy between research and teaching, resulting in a vibrant learning environment as staff incorporate new research into their classes.
The theatre course will allow you to develop your understanding and practical skills by exploring critical and historical frameworks alongside practical workshops. There are opportunities to engage with professional theatre makers and our museum-accredited archive, the Theatre Collection.
For German, as well as following a structured language course, you will build your practical skills and explore critical and historical frameworks through literature, history, thought, politics, linguistics and culture. You will spend your third year abroad in a German-speaking country, extending your language skills and cultural knowledge. Visit Global Opportunities to find out more about where you can study abroad.
When you return to Bristol for your final year you will have the opportunity to undertake an independent practical or written research project and/or a work placement in the creative industries.

Bachelor of Science in Environmental Geoscience
Examine the interactions between the geology, biology, chemistry and physics of Earth’s surface, oceans and atmosphere and gain a deep understanding of Earth’s environment and how it can be influenced by human activities.
Learn with experts whose research feeds directly into your studies at the cutting edge of scientific developments. Recent options have included Soils and the Critical Zone, Environmental Impact Assessments, Oceans and Climates, and Environmental Radioactivity.
By your final year you’ll be conducting your own independent research and exploring the questions that matter most to you.
We have a friendly community and a program of student-run projects, informal seminars and social events. Field trips are a huge part of why our school community is so tight knit, giving you the chance to get to know your course mates and key staff, while honing your practical skills. You will gain plenty of hands-on experience, with over 40 days of fieldwork both in the UK and overseas, the cost of which is included in your tuition fee.
The skills developed throughout your studies are highly valued by employers – from scientific and technical skills including coding, modelling, lab skills, and data analysis – to transferable skills such as communication, creativity and resilience.

Bachelor of Arts in Comparative Literatures and Cultures and Spanish
Our BA Comparative Literatures and Cultures degree offers an unmatched opportunity to study international cultural production in both depth and breadth. You will study global literatures and cultures in comparative frameworks that draw on methodologies from textual, cultural and visual studies, as well as from translation, philosophy, history, social science and critical theory. Texts will be read in English translation.
Core units in years one and two currently include: What is Comparative Literature and How Do We Practise It?; Introduction to Visual Cultures; Popular Representation and Institutions of Culture; Migrations of Culture. Additionally, you will have a wide choice of optional units based in the culture of a single language or a combination of cultures.
You will spend your third year in a Spanish-speaking country, where you will undertake university study, a British Council assistantship or a work placement. You will follow a programme of study in Spanish, developing linguistic skills enabling you to communicate easily in writing and orally. For more information about the year abroad, visit Global Opportunities.
In year four you will complete an innovative supervised independent project, consisting of an extended essay on a topic of your choice and a public-facing element presented to the entire cohort (e.g. prospectus, interview, museum catalogue entries, newspaper article).
You will be taught by experts in the field and teaching is informed by staff research interests. The course is delivered in varied ways through lectures, tutorials, seminars, workshops and one-to-one supervision. You will participate in small-group teaching and may be asked to give introductory talks to initiate discussion.
This course encourages attributes highly valued by employers, including intercultural understanding, analytical and critical thinking, clarity and self confidence in communication, an aptitude for collaborative work, and creativity. It will instil habits of curiosity, openness, rigour, self reflection and evidence-based thinking, preparing you for a career in various sectors.
